Copy detection patterns (CDP) are an attractive technology that allows
manufacturers to defend their products against counterfeiting. The main
assumption behind the protection mechanism of CDP is that these codes printed
with the smallest symbol size (1x1) on an industrial printer cannot be copied
or cloned with sufficient accuracy due to data processing inequality. However,
previous works have shown that Machine Learning (ML) based attacks can produce
high-quality fakes, resulting in decreased accuracy of authentication based on
